About the UPCATET PG Mock Test 2025
The Uttar Pradesh Combined Agriculture and Technology Entrance Test (UPCATET) is a state-level entrance exam conducted by Chandra Shekhar Azad University of Agriculture and Technology, Kanpur. It offers admission to various Undergraduate (UG), Postgraduate (PG), and Ph.D. programs in agriculture, veterinary, and technology courses across six participating universities in Uttar Pradesh.
